Odyssey of Homer: Polyphemus, the Cyclops, Illustration by Antoine Calbet

(Odyssee d'Homere: “” The Cyclops Polypheme”” (Polyphemus, the Cyclops) Illustration by Antoine Calbet (1860-1944) for “The odyssee” by the Greek poet Homere (Odyssey by Homer) 1897 Private collection)
